Dogecoin (DOGE) price experienced a major 30% price decrease during the last month when it reached its $0.47 peak value in November 2024. Market bearishness, together with the industry-wide cryptocurrency market correction, remains responsible for this decrease.
Latest reports indicate a dramatic shift in the Dogecoin investor profile, with fewer people holding cryptocurrency worth $1 million or more. The change takes place as the overall cryptocurrency market is experiencing corrections and price swings, impacting the net worth of most digital asset holders.

There is a substantial resistance cluster for Shiba Inu at the $0.000013 price level, where investors hold 551 trillion SHIB at a loss. This extreme concentration of supply raises the possibility that many addresses are trying to break even or turn a profit at this point, which could lead to a price reversal.

The SEC said Thursday that proof-of-work crypto mining—as seen with Bitcoin and Dogecoin—does not fall under its definition of securities.
